The tour comprises of four key areas:
The Receiving Centre
This is where the local farmers drop
off their dates. In the Receiving Centre
the dates are received in 3 categories
of quality ‘Good’, ‘Medium’ and
‘Animal feed’. A quality assurance
officer is always present to ensure
that the dates are of the standard
required by AFC. There are over 157
commercial varieties of dates in the
UAE. During the receiving process, it
is of vital importance that dates are
correctly classified according to their
variety and quality of grade. Farmers
are provided with training on how to
take care of their date palms and also
on how to identify the different types
of dates among etc. Receiving of dates
is done between the months of July to
November.
Storage
Dates are divided into two main
categories, organic and regular
dates. Dates are cleaned, sorted
and stored, at a temperature from
0-5 degrees. They are washed three
times under high pressure to ensure
that all sediments and/or insects are
removed. They are dried by cold air
and then stored manually. Organic
dates do not undergo the fumigation
process.
Here are some additional interesting
facts on dates that the AFC shared
with us:
• Dates never spoil. They are
preserved and are available all
yearlong.
• When offered Arabic coffee and
dates; proper etiquette is to take
dates in odd numbers (1, 3, 5 or 7).
The Dallah coffee pot should be in
the left hand of the person serving
and the coffee cup in the right
hand. The coffee should merely
cover the base of the cup. The
person serving will wait for you to
signal for more when you hold the
cup forward or refuse by shaking
the cup.
• Syrup, paste and honey are all
products that can be made from
dates. Sweets are also made
from dates. Some are mixed with
chocolate, pistachio, almonds,
cardamom and saffron.

Sorting
This entails loading
the dates on to high
tech sorting machinery,
which makes use of a
laser beam to sort the
dates according to the
condition, colour and
sizes. Sorting by optical
sorters gives 4 grades
of dates based on size
‘A’ being the largest and
‘D’ the smallest.
Packaging
This is also made easy
with the use of high
technology equipment.
There are several brands
under the Al Foah
Company umbrella. These include Al
Saad, Date Crown, Al Dhafra Dates
and Zadina, which is produced for Al
Foah Showrooms. Once the products
are packaged, they are prepped
for distribution to local and foreign
customers.

In keeping with worldwide and strict
GCC policies for the exportation of
goods, EcoCert carries out periodic
inspections of the facility and Al Foah
Company farms. Al Foah Company
also ensures that the facility operates
at the highest standards through staff
training every six months. Medicals are
also conducted at frequent intervals.
